If you’ve traveled with kids, you’ll likely hear, “Are we there yet?” Based on the frequency of this question, they must believe their words can speed the journey up. After driving across Texas, I, too, found myself asking the same thing (and no, it didn’t make the trip faster!). At times, life can feel like a long road trip that has us asking similar questions:

When will I arrive?

Am I on the right road?

Can I trust the map?

Did I make a wrong turn?

Am I lost?

God has given His children a reliable map that we can trust. Psalm 119:105 tells us that God’s word is a lamp for our feet and a light for our path. Most of us wouldn’t request a dimly lit lamp but prefer a vivid spotlight that illuminates the entire way—or so we think. In His wisdom, God understands that we can’t handle everything at once, so He guides us step by step as we journey home.

Having guidance as we go sure beats the alternative we desire. For example, how would you respond if you volunteered to drive a friend to their house and they gave you turn-by-turn instructions all at one time? Most of us would be overwhelmed! Instead, it would be best to ask them to guide you as you go and only tell you to turn when needed. Even if the road is bumpy, uphill, dark, or narrow, you can relax because your friend knows the way. Instead of worrying about getting lost, you can trust your knowledgeable guide, engage in conversation, and enjoy the journey.

The same is true with God. Our relationship with Him grows when we study His “roadmap” and seek His guidance. Worry will take a backseat when we have confidence in the Navigator. Deuteronomy 31:8 elucidates this beautiful truth, “the LORD is the one who is going ahead of you; He will be with you. He will not desert you or abandon you. Do not fear, and do not be dismayed.”

With Him by our side, we can fully trust our knowledgeable guide, engage in conversation, and enjoy the journey (even on dark, scary roads). Why? Because Jesus knows the way, shows the way, goes the way, and is The Way.
